Task Prioritization and Time Blocking for Traders
One effective method to boost productivity in crypto trading is task prioritization. By organizing tasks based on urgency and importance, traders can ensure that their efforts are focused on activities that drive results. Time blocking, which involves setting specific time slots for different tasks, further enhances this approach by creating a disciplined routine. Below is an example of how time-blocking can be implemented:
- Market Research: Allocate the first hour of your trading day to market analysis, reading relevant news, and studying charts.
- Trade Execution: Block out time mid-day for executing planned trades and adjusting strategies.
- Portfolio Review: Set aside time at the end of the day for portfolio assessment and risk management.
Using the Eisenhower Matrix to Streamline Crypto Decisions
The Eisenhower Matrix is a valuable tool for sorting tasks by urgency and importance, helping traders distinguish between what needs immediate attention and what can be handled later. Below is a simple layout of how to use this method for prioritizing crypto-related tasks:
Urgent & Important | Not Urgent but Important |
---|---|
Responding to sudden price drops or market news | Studying new altcoins or upcoming ICOs |
Executing trades in real-time | Long-term portfolio strategy review |
Urgent but Not Important | Not Urgent and Not Important |
Minor adjustments to trading settings | Browsing unrelated crypto forums |
Important Tip: Always focus on tasks that are both urgent and important. Avoid wasting time on non-essential activities that do not contribute to your trading goals.

Overcoming Common Obstacles in Cryptocurrency Entrepreneurship
Entrepreneurship in the cryptocurrency industry presents unique challenges that require innovative solutions. From market volatility to regulatory uncertainties, understanding how to navigate these obstacles is crucial for success. With the rapid development of blockchain technology, entrepreneurs need to adapt quickly while staying ahead of the curve to seize opportunities.
One of the most common hurdles is managing risk in an unpredictable market. Cryptocurrencies are known for their price fluctuations, making it difficult to plan and forecast business growth. Entrepreneurs must implement strategies that help mitigate these risks while capitalizing on the potential high returns.
Key Challenges and Solutions
- Market Volatility: Cryptocurrency prices can swing dramatically, which may lead to financial instability.
- Regulatory Uncertainty: The lack of consistent global regulations makes it hard to operate in different markets.
- Security Issues: With frequent reports of hacks and frauds, ensuring secure transactions is vital for success.
To address these obstacles, entrepreneurs can focus on the following approaches:
- Implementing Risk Management Tools: Using hedging strategies or stablecoins to protect assets from volatile swings.
- Compliance Monitoring: Stay updated on local and international laws regarding cryptocurrency to ensure legal operations.
- Investing in Cybersecurity: Protect both the business and customer assets by using advanced encryption and secure blockchain protocols.
"In a rapidly evolving market like cryptocurrency, it is essential to balance risk with innovation. By understanding the obstacles and embracing proactive solutions, entrepreneurs can turn challenges into opportunities."
Table of Risk Management Approaches
Risk Factor | Solution | Tools/Methods |
---|---|---|
Price Volatility | Hedging and Diversification | Stablecoins, Futures Contracts |
Regulatory Compliance | Staying Informed on Laws | Legal Consultants, Compliance Software |
Cybersecurity | Enhanced Encryption & Monitoring | Multi-Factor Authentication, Blockchain Security Protocols |

Legal Considerations for Cryptocurrency in Business Expansion
Expanding a business into the cryptocurrency space requires careful attention to regulatory compliance and legal frameworks. As digital currencies continue to gain traction globally, businesses must ensure they are operating within the legal boundaries of each jurisdiction they enter. This can involve navigating complex laws regarding cryptocurrency transactions, taxation, and anti-money laundering (AML) policies, which vary significantly from one region to another.
Additionally, cryptocurrency companies must consider the legal implications of their operations, including issues of intellectual property, security standards, and customer data protection. With the rise of decentralized finance (DeFi) and tokenized assets, businesses must stay informed about evolving legal landscapes to avoid penalties or legal challenges that could arise from non-compliance.
Key Legal Areas to Address
- Regulatory Compliance: Businesses must adhere to local and international regulations related to cryptocurrency transactions, such as the EU's MiCA framework or the U.S. SEC's guidelines.
- Licensing Requirements: Certain jurisdictions require businesses to obtain specific licenses before engaging in cryptocurrency operations, such as money transmitter licenses or cryptocurrency exchange registrations.
-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and KYC: Compliance with AML and Know Your Customer (KYC) laws is crucial for preventing illegal activities within cryptocurrency transactions.
Legal Risks to Consider
- Jurisdictional Issues: Determining which country’s laws apply to your business can be difficult due to differing cryptocurrency regulations worldwide.
- Consumer Protection: Ensuring that customer funds and data are securely managed to avoid legal repercussions related to data breaches or fraud.
- Taxation: Different jurisdictions may tax cryptocurrency profits in various ways, so businesses must be proactive in understanding and reporting tax obligations.
Table: Cryptocurrency Regulation Overview
Region | Regulation | Licensing Requirements |
---|---|---|
European Union | MiCA (Markets in Crypto-Assets Regulation) | Crypto service providers must register with national regulators. |
United States | SEC Guidelines, FinCEN Regulations | Money transmitter license required in most states. |
Singapore | Payment Services Act | License required for digital payment token services. |
